Individual therapy gives children, teens, and young adults a place to talk openly, understand what they are going through, and learn how to handle life in a healthier and more confident way. Between ages 11 and 21, a lot of change happens. School, friendships, family relationships, identity, independence, college, and future plans can all feel exciting, stressful, confusing, or overwhelming at different times.
Many clients start individual therapy because they feel anxious, down, overwhelmed, angry, stressed, or not like themselves. Others come to therapy after a difficult experience or during a big life transition. Some are not sure exactly what is wrong, but they know they want things to feel different. Individual therapy gives them a space to slow down, talk through what is happening, and start figuring things out.
What Individual Therapy Can Help With
Individual therapy can help clients work through many different areas of life, including:
Anxiety and stress
Depression and low mood
Disordered eating and body image concerns
Anger and frustration
School stress or academic pressure
Friendship and social challenges
Family changes or conflict
Life transitions and college adjustment
Self esteem and confidence
Grief or difficult experiences
Therapy also helps clients learn practical skills like managing emotions, handling stress, communicating better, setting boundaries, and making decisions with more confidence.
